See and believe." "Who has taken it down ?" cried Richard, remarking that the picture had certainly disappeared.
"No mortal hand," replied Nicholas.

"It has come down of itself.

I knew what would happen, Dick.

I told you the fair votaress gave me the _clin d'oeil_--the wink.

You would not believe me then--and now you see your mistake." "I see nothing but the bare wall," said Richard.
"But you will see something anon, Dick," rejoined Nicholas, with a hollow laugh, and in a dismally deep tone.
